- **Event Description**: The Writers Guild at Bloomington presents Last Sunday Poetry, featuring J.I.B. & Nikki Chaos.


J.I.B. is a prose poet and essayist from Southern Ohio. His work has been published in journals, magazines, and various Midwest presses. You can follow his work, travels, and performances on Instagram @j.i.b.trash.poet or on Facebook @ J Ian Bush. 


Praise for American Television, by J.I.B.:

"What makes J.I.B.'s *American Television* (Spartan Press, 2024) great is its pulsating subtext of sincerity--that cries out against the toxicity of contemporary American life, much like Allen Ginsberg's 'Howl.' These poems are just as eloquent and urgently relevant for today's generation."

--Hiromi Yoshida, Chair, Writers Guild at Bloomington


NIKKI CHAOS is a confessional poet from Portsmouth, Ohio and author of the book *Pussy.* In addition to poetry, Nikki performs various sideshow acts including sword swallowing and fire eating and spent 15 years as a journalist.


Praise for Pussy, by Nikki Chaos:

"Nikki Chaos's *Pussy* is raw and visceral, taking confessional poetry to a radical raggedy edge. Nikki converts her amazing survival experiences into words that have fire and punch. As Lydia Lunch might say, she has punched her way 'out of the trauma zone into the light'."

--Hiromi Yoshida
